BHG Financial

About

BHG Financial has moved $27 billion in unsecured loans since 2001, building a lending engine that lives on proprietary analytics and quantitative modeling. The attack surface is real: sensitive financial data at scale, a network of over 1,700 community bank partners, and a platform where a single breach could ripple across institutional relationships. The company's core loan program touts zero dollar losses for bank partners, which means data integrity and fraud detection aren't aspirational - they're existential.

From a security perspective, the threat model centers on protecting PII and financial data in a high-volume lending pipeline. The tech stack is driven by data-driven decisioning and cutting-edge technology, which implies cloud infrastructure, real-time analytics pipelines, and APIs feeding institutional partners. BHG operates out of Fort Lauderdale and Syracuse, serving a US-based financial services vertical that includes fintech and originally healthcare - a sector with its own regulatory weight.

The company started in 2001 with $25,000 in initial capital and has since scaled into a multi-billion-dollar originator. For security engineers, the draw is concrete: hardening a fintech platform where the stakes are quantifiable, the data flows are measurable, and the institutional trust layer means security isn't bolted on - it's structural.
